Was a tough day, thought fo sho I was dying a slow cold death in my boat yesterday. Fish were super sluggish, deep water with cover. We managed a few short fish, with my partner, JUNIOR WORLD CHAMPION JOHNNIE DUARTE catching the only keeper. Just had to toss his name out there, he can flat out fish. Not sure what the winning weight was, but it was definately under 10lbs. Once again, its called fishing not catching, but it was still fun, despite the steady winds. Until next time, I'm taking the winter off, soon to return with a vengeance. LMFAO.
